Warm Beige BrownThis shade combines the warmth of brown with a hint of beige, making it a versatile choice for any living room. It pairs beautifully with white trim and can complement both traditional and contemporary furniture styles.2. Rich Chocolate BrownIf you’re aiming for a dramatic effect, rich chocolate brown is an excellent option. This deep hue can create a cozy atmosphere, especially when combined with soft lighting and plush textures.3. Sandy BrownSandy brown is a lighter, softer option that brings a touch of nature indoors. It works particularly well in spaces where natural light floods in, enhancing the warm tones and creating a serene environment.4. TaupeThis neutral blend of brown and gray is perfect for those who prefer a more muted palette. Taupe can serve as a great backdrop, allowing colorful decor and furniture pieces to stand out.5. Chestnut BrownChestnut brown offers a medium tone that is both rich and inviting. It’s particularly suited for creating a warm, welcoming atmosphere, making it great for family gatherings.Tips for Choosing Brown Paint ColorsWhen selecting the perfect shade of brown for your living room, consider testing samples on your walls first. Lighting can drastically change the appearance of paint colors, so observing them at different times of the day is vital.Have you considered how different textures can affect your choice? A matte finish may appear more subdued, while a glossy finish can amplify the color’s richness.
